Ticket: export retry drift

Failed exports on Quillport stopped retrying after last week's rollout. Cause: retry backoff settings on prod diverged from the committed defaults — someone bumped max attempts to zero during an incident and never reverted. Fix the source of truth, then redeploy. Do not hot-patch again. The current (drifted) values are captured below for the record.

deployment values, kajep-kageg:
[praix]
host = praix.paliqcorp.corp
user = praix_svc
database = praix_prod

Subject: DR drill results — Memlens GPU profiler

Team,

We ran the quarterly disaster-recovery drill for Memlens, our GPU memory profiling toolkit, yesterday. Restoring the trace archive from cold storage took 40 minutes, within target. One gap: the profiler's encrypted symbol cache couldn't be rebuilt without manual intervention, so future maintainers should know the recovery path. After restoring the cache volume, the unlock utility will prompt for the recovery passphrase recorded below.

unlock words, hahip-baduf: holwyn-istath-julvan

## Onboarding — Markdown Pipeline (Inkmere)

Inkmere docs render through a three-stage pipeline: parse, sanitize, emit. Releases rebuild all templates; never hot-patch emitted HTML. Broken renders usually mean a sanitizer rule change — check the rules diff first. The render cluster only accepts builds from the release channel, and every build artifact must be signed before upload. Sign artifacts with the deploy key below.

release key, hafop-tajef: bky13_s2vaFVNJTHfBL

## Local setup

Quillbird watches `config/local.toml` and hot-reloads most settings without a restart — handy when you're tweaking rate limits or log levels. A few things (port bindings, TLS paths) still need a full restart, and the watcher will grumble in the logs if you change those. The reloader also re-resolves the database handle each cycle, using the connection string below.

primary connection of tajeg-tajop = postgresql://julax_svc:DI@db-e7f3.kelvidyn.corp:5432/rusdor